17 ID THEFT - DEFINITION Obtaining the Personal Identifying Information of another person AND using it to do something illegal. PC 530.5

18 COMMON EXAMPLES: Victim s credit card used to make fraudulent purchases. Victim s PII used to fraudulently open an account. Victim s PII used to manufacture counterfeit checks and/or identifications.

21 PERSONAL IDENTIFYING INFORMATION - PC (b) Name and address. Telephone number. Driver's license number. Social security number. Place of employment. Employee identification number. Government passport number. Unique electronic data routing code.

22 PERSONAL IDENTIFYING INFORMATION PC (b) Mother's maiden name. Demand deposit account number. Savings account number. Credit card number. PIN or password. Unique biometric data like fingerprints. Voice print. Etc.

23 WHO IS A PERSON? PENAL CODE (a) Natural Person (living or deceased) Firm Association Organization Partnership Business trust Company or Corporation Limited liability company Public entity

28 Jury Scam Alert The Administrative Office of the Courts has seen a recent resurgence in use of a jury identity theft scam. More than a dozen states-including Californiahave issued public warnings about calls from people claiming to be court officials seeking personal information. The Federal Bureau of Investigation is aware of the scam and cautions people against falling prey to these callers.

29 Jury Scam Alert The Administrative Office of the Courts and Staff of the superior courts will never ask past or prospective jurors for financial details, credit card numbers, bank account or personal information like Social Security numbers. Please do not provide this type of information to anyone claiming to be associated with the courts.

32 WIRELESS ACCESS POINTS Risk #1 Exposure of data on computer. Risk #2 Exposure of data to & from WAP. Risk #3 Unauthorized use of your WAP. Solution = WAP security i.e. lock down!

33 WAP SECURITY TIPS 1. Change WAP default name. 2. Change WAP administrator password. 3. Enable WAP s encryption feature. 4. Enable MAC address control (PC adapter card). 5. Download WAP software updates for patches. 6. Install and use antivirus software on your PC.

47 LOW-TECH METHODS OF OBTAINING PII Mail theft Theft wallets, purses & other personal property Residential & auto burglary Dumpster diving & garbage Social engineering via phone Insider employee theft Violence/homicide

52 PENAL CODE METHODS OF VIOLATING 1. Use of PII - PC 530.5(a) 2. Acquire/retain PII PC 530.5(c)(1) (3) 3. Sale/transfer PII PC 530.5(d)(1)

53 COMMON WAYS PII IS USED Create counterfeit identifications Credit card account takeovers Open new credit card accounts

54 COMMON WAYS PII IS USED Open new bank accounts Make/negotiate counterfeit checks Money laundering

55 COMMON WAYS PII IS USED Purchase vehicles/real estate Bankruptcy filings automatic stay Escape arrest/ prosecution

65 REDUCING THE RISK Accept reality - your PII is an asset. Proactively securing your PII by reducing access to it. Secure your PII in safe place. Use secure mailboxes. Safeguard your personal property, such as wallets & purses. Use a cross-shredder to discard PII.

66 REDUCING THE RISK Use a credit card instead of a debit card. Use a security freeze to block your credit block profile. Do not use common passwords/pins, such as birth date, maiden name, etc. Don t give out your pi over the phone unless you know the caller. Check your credit report every 3 months to verify no fraud activity.

67 BASIC 4 STEPS IF VICTIMIZED? File a police report in city where you reside or place of business. Contact the merchant/issuer of credit to close line of credit. Contact the 3 credit bureas. (Experian, trans union & equifax) CONTACT THE FEDERAL TRADE COMMISSION AT OR ONLINE AT

68 ID THEFT VICTIM RIGHTS OVERVIEW 1. File an identity theft police report. PC 530.6(a) - City of residence or place of business 2. Obtain copies of documents related to the fraud. PC 530.8(a) 3. Remove fraudulent information from credit files. CA Civil Code et seq, Fed. Fair Credit Reporting Act, etc.

69 ID THEFT VICTIM RIGHTS OVERVIEW 4. Right to receive up to 12 free credits reports (1 per mo). 1 Year from date of police report. CA CC (b) 5. Right to stop debt collection on fraud transactions. CA CC Right to sue or assert a defense regarding ownership of property obtained through identity theft. CA CC

70 ID THEFT VICTIM RIGHTS CRIME COMMITTED IN VICTIM S NAME 7. Expedited Superior court hearing and judge s order finding victim factually innocent. -Criminal record then deleted, sealed or labeled fraud. -PC Listing in CA DOJ Identity Theft Victim Registry. -PC & PC 530.7
